What does the name Amoroso mean?
The meaning and origin of Amoroso
English
noun

A male lover.

Etymology: Borrowed from Italian amoroso. Doublet of amorous and amoureux.

Spanish
adj
//amoˈɾoso//

amorous; loving

Etymology: Inherited from Vulgar Latin *amōrōsus, derived from Latin amōrem (“love”). By surface analysis, amor + -oso.

French
adv
//a.mɔ.ʁo.zo//

in a tender, loving style

Etymology: From Italian amoroso. Doublet of amoureux.

Italian
adj
//a.moˈro.zo//

amorous, loving

Etymology: From Vulgar Latin *amōrōsus, derived from Latin amōrem (“love”). By surface analysis, amore + -oso.

Portuguese
adj
//a.moˈɾo.zu//

loving

Etymology: From Vulgar Latin *amōrōsus, derived from Latin amōrem (“love”). By surface analysis, amor + -oso.

Romanian
adv

amoroso

Etymology: Unadapted borrowing from Italian amoroso.
